diff --git a/sw/source/core/undo/undel.cxx b/sw/source/core/undo/undel.cxx index ba1d9210359d..6b4b4b3786de 100644 --- a/sw/source/core/undo/undel.cxx +++ b/sw/source/core/undo/undel.cxx @@ -965,7 +965,8 @@ void SwUndoDelete::UndoImpl(::sw::UndoRedoContext & rContext) SwNodeIndex aMvIdx(rDoc.GetNodes(), nMoveIndex); SwNodeRange aRg( aPos.nNode, 0, aPos.nNode, 1 ); pMovedNode = &aPos.nNode.GetNode(); - rDoc.GetNodes().MoveNodes(aRg, rDoc.GetNodes(), aMvIdx); + // tdf#131684 without deleting frames + rDoc.GetNodes().MoveNodes(aRg, rDoc.GetNodes(), aMvIdx, false); rDoc.GetNodes().Delete( aMvIdx); } }